356 | dnl # | |
357 | dnl # Detect the kernel to be built against | |
358 | dnl # | |
72f3c8b1 DS |
359 | dnl # Most modern Linux distributions have separate locations for bare |
360 | dnl # source (source) and prebuilt (build) files. Additionally, there are | |
361 | dnl # `source` and `build` symlinks in `/lib/modules/$(KERNEL_VERSION)` | |
362 | dnl # pointing to them. The directory search order is now: | |
363 | dnl # | |
364 | dnl # - `configure` command line values if both `--with-linux` and | |
365 | dnl # `--with-linux-obj` were defined | |
366 | dnl # | |
367 | dnl # - If only `--with-linux` was defined, `--with-linux-obj` is assumed | |
368 | dnl # to have the same value as `--with-linux` | |
369 | dnl # | |
370 | dnl # - If neither `--with-linux` nor `--with-linux-obj` were defined | |
371 | dnl # autodetection is used: | |
372 | dnl # | |
373 | dnl # - `/lib/modules/$(uname -r)/{source,build}` respectively, if exist. | |
374 | dnl # | |
375 | dnl # - If only `/lib/modules/$(uname -r)/build` exists, it is assumed | |
376 | dnl # to be both source and build directory. | |
377 | dnl # | |
378 | dnl # - The first directory in `/lib/modules` with the highest version | |
379 | dnl # number according to `sort -V` which contains both `source` and | |
380 | dnl # `build` symlinks/directories. If module directory contains only | |
381 | dnl # `build` component, it is assumed to be both source and build | |
382 | dnl # directory. | |
383 | dnl # | |
384 | dnl # - Last resort: the first directory matching `/usr/src/kernels/*` | |
385 | dnl # and `/usr/src/linux-*` with the highest version number according | |
386 | dnl # to `sort -V` is assumed to be both source and build directory. | |
387 | dnl # | |

6a9d6359 | 516 | dnl # |
608f8749 BB |
517 | dnl # Detect the QAT module to be built against, QAT provides hardware |
518 | dnl # acceleration for data compression: | |
519 | dnl # | |
520 | dnl # https://01.org/intel-quickassist-technology | |
521 | dnl # | |
522 | dnl # 1) Download and install QAT driver from the above link | |
523 | dnl # 2) Start QAT driver in your system: | |
524 | dnl # service qat_service start | |
525 | dnl # 3) Enable QAT in ZFS, e.g.: | |
526 | dnl # ./configure --with-qat=<qat-driver-path>/QAT1.6 | |
527 | dnl # make | |
528 | dnl # 4) Set GZIP compression in ZFS dataset: | |
529 | dnl # zfs set compression = gzip <dataset> | |
530 | dnl # | |
531 | dnl # Then the data written to this ZFS pool is compressed by QAT accelerator | |
532 | dnl # automatically, and de-compressed by QAT when read from the pool. | |
533 | dnl # | |
534 | dnl # 1) Get QAT hardware statistics with: | |
535 | dnl # cat /proc/icp_dh895xcc_dev/qat | |
536 | dnl # 2) To disable QAT: | |
537 | dnl # insmod zfs.ko zfs_qat_disable=1 | |
6a9d6359 | 538 | dnl # |

748 | dnl # | |
608f8749 | 749 | dnl # Perform the compilation of the test cases in two phases. |
0b39b9f9 | 750 | dnl # |
608f8749 BB |
751 | dnl # Phase 1) attempt to build the object files for all of the tests |
752 | dnl # defined by the ZFS_LINUX_TEST_SRC macro. But do not | |
753 | dnl # perform the final modpost stage. | |
754 | dnl # | |
755 | dnl # Phase 2) disable all tests which failed the initial compilation, | |
756 | dnl # then invoke the final modpost step for the remaining tests. | |
757 | dnl # | |
758 | dnl # This allows us efficiently build the test cases in parallel while | |
759 | dnl # remaining resilient to build failures which are expected when | |
760 | dnl # detecting the available kernel interfaces. | |
761 | dnl # | |
762 | dnl # The maximum allowed parallelism can be controlled by setting the | |
763 | dnl # TEST_JOBS environment variable. Otherwise, it default to $(nproc). | |
764 | dnl # | |
